2. Absence & Make-Up Classes
Each student is entitled to one complimentary make-up opportunity per school term.
Where a student misses a class, CommuniKids will prioritise arranging a make-up by placing the student in another suitable class of the same duration and equivalent value, subject to availability.
The content covered in the alternative class may not directly continue from the student’s regular class and may not match the exact lesson that was missed. However, CommuniKids will ensure that the alternative class is appropriate for the student’s age, current learning level and ability.
If no suitable equivalent class is available, CommuniKids may instead arrange a 20-minute one-on-one make-up session with a teacher.
CommuniKids may also provide relevant lesson materials, worksheets or teacher notes so that the student can catch up on missed content at home with the support of a parent or guardian.
From the second make-up request onwards within the same school term, a $30 make-up fee applies for each teacher-led make-up session, whether the make-up is arranged through an alternative group class or a 20-minute one-on-one session.
Where a family only receives lesson materials, worksheets or teacher notes to complete at home, this is not considered a teacher-led make-up session.
All make-up arrangements are subject to class and teacher availability and must be confirmed with CommuniKids in advance.
Make-up opportunities should be used within the relevant school term and cannot be accumulated or carried forward indefinitely.
3. Withdrawal & Refunds
Families wishing to withdraw from a course must provide at least four weeks’ written notice.
For withdrawals taking effect during a school term, an amount equivalent to two weeks’ tuition fees will be retained.
If written notice is provided at least four weeks before the beginning of the next school term and the student will not be continuing into that term, no additional withdrawal compensation fee will apply.
Any remaining refundable fees will be processed within 14 business days.
